Black Sheep Coffee wants to nearly double its stores by February next year.
The coffee chain has 43 stores, mostly in London, but also has outposts in Glasgow, Manchester and Paris.
It is now looking at opening 35 more in smaller towns such as Guildford and Colchester, and is eyeing sites at out-of-town retail destinations and designer outlets.